python – Easter's Domo https://domo.easter.fr Home Automation Stuff Mon, 11 Dec 2017 13:53:38 +0000 fr-FR hourly 1 https://wordpress.org/?v=6.9 MiFlora v2 https://domo.easter.fr/2017/12/11/miflora-v2/ https://domo.easter.fr/2017/12/11/miflora-v2/#respond Mon, 11 Dec 2017 13:50:00 +0000 https://domo.easter.fr/?p=134 Une petite mise à jour au niveau du script pour Miflora.

Il y a eu des changements au niveau de la communication via bluetooth apparemment.

Du coup le code à été mis à jour dans le dépôt github : https://github.com/open-homeautomation/miflora

Il suffit de retourner à l’emplacement ou vous avez clone le dépôt la premiere fois et faire un :

git pull

J’ai adapté le script en fonction :

[pastacode lang= »python » user= »chatainsim » repos= »scripts_domoticz » path_id= »miflorav2.py » revision= » » highlight= » » lines= » » provider= »github »/]

Pour rappel, le premier script est ici mais chez moi il ne semble plus fonctionner.

Par contre il y a encore la mise en place en crontab qui peut être utile.

 

 

]]>
https://domo.easter.fr/2017/12/11/miflora-v2/feed/ 0 standard
Mi Flower et Domoticz https://domo.easter.fr/2017/02/09/mi-flower-et-domoticz/ https://domo.easter.fr/2017/02/09/mi-flower-et-domoticz/#comments Thu, 09 Feb 2017 14:15:30 +0000 https://domo.easter.fr/?p=41

Comment remonter les informations du Mi Flower dans Domoticz.

Prérequis :

  • python3
  • git
  • bluez
  • clé bluetooth (v4?)

Il faut créer deux sensors virtuels, un pour la température et l’humidité et l’autre pour « l’engrais »

Comme pour Vigicrues, il faut un Hardware Dummy puis la création de deux sensors virtuel.

Pensez à récupérer les deux idx correspondant aux sensors.

 

Récupérer miflora, la librairie pour lire le capteur bluetooth :

git clone https://github.com/open-homeautomation/miflora.git

Aller dans le répertoire miflora créé puis éditer le fichier demo.py ou créer un autre script à côté.

Voici le code du script :

[pastacode lang= »python » user= »chatainsim » repos= »scripts_domoticz » path_id= »miflora.py » revision= »master » highlight= » » lines= » » provider= »github »/]

Il suffit de faire tourner le script en crontab toute les heures par exemples.

]]>
https://domo.easter.fr/2017/02/09/mi-flower-et-domoticz/feed/ 3 standard